Y4 GUB is a 2018 Land Rover Range Rover in Black with a 4,367c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2018 Land Rover Range Rover models, the average MOT pass rate is 89.2% with a typical mileage of 44,155 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Land Rover Range Rover f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 63,439 recorded failures. If you're considering buying Y4 GUB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Land Rover Range Rover typ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 8 years old, this Land Rover Range Rover is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
